House of the Dead owns a special place in my heart. While others were at the arcade pumping quarters into Tekken or Street Fighter, I was lined up at the HOTD 2 machine. Whether it be $2 or $20, I would have to spend it all in some zombie slaying lightgun action. Well, now the game is coming to the Wii, so get ready for more lightgun-esque awesomeness! The game is taking on a grindhouse theme this go round, and I can say that judging by the videos I’ve seen, it works. You’ll be stepping into the shoes of Agent G during his rookie year, what an initiation he receives! The game’s going to take you to a mental hospital, swamp and what may be the scariest Carnival ever. Luckily for all of us, the game is right around the corner and should hit next week.
